Odigie gives reasons for Bendel Insurance's draw with Kwara United
Bendel Insurance head coach, Monday Odigie has attributed his team's 2-2 draw against Kwara United to complacency.
The Benin Arsenals rallied twice to earn a share of the spoils in the keenly contested encounter.
Odigie emphasized that the team still need time to be ready.
The gaffer however assured that his team will continue to improve as the season progresses.
“The first half was full of complacency from the Bendel Insurance players,” he stated in a post-match interview.
“As I rightly said the team needs time to be ready but we will continue to improve game after game.”
Bendel Insurance occupy sixth position on the table with 13 points.
